Siemens Gamesa secures EPC contract for $350m Bulgana Green Power Hub

Monica Gameng   |   April 12, 2018

The engineering, procurement and construction (EPC) contract for Neoen Australia’s $350 million Bulgana Green Power Hub development has been awarded to Siemens Gamesa Renewable Energy (SGRE), with major construction activities to begin immediately.

Under their contract, SGRE will build the hybrid 194MW wind farm plus 20MW / 34MWh lithium-ion battery storage facility – located near Stawell in Victoria – as well as maintain the Bulgana Green Power Hub for 25 years.

The Bulgana Green Power Hub has already secured two power purchase agreement (PPA). This includes a 15-year PPA with the Victorian Government as well as a 10-year PPA with Nectar Farms.

Approximately 15 per cent of the generated power from Bulgana will go to Nectar Farms to be utilised for their greenhouses, with the remaining wind-battery generated electricity going to the local grid.

The Bulgana Green Power Hub is expected to be operational by August 2019.
